The Iberian Pig is a vibrant and modern Spanish tapas restaurant with locations in Decatur, Atlanta, Nashville, and Charlotte. Renowned for its creative and shareable Spanish-inspired tapas, the restaurant offers an extensive wine list featuring the finest Spanish wines as well as craft cocktails, all served within an energetic and fast-paced environment. The Iberian Pig is dedicated to delivering exceptional hospitality and a memorable dining experience, with a team that embodies professionalism and a passion for culinary excellence.

Job Requirements
- high school diploma or equivalent
- minimum 3 years experience in kitchen leadership roles
- ability to work in fast-paced environment
- physical ability to bend, stretch, stand for long periods, and lift up to 50 pounds
- strong leadership and decision-making skills
- ability to train and manage staff
- knowledge of kitchen safety and sanitation guidelines
Job Qualifications
- 3+ years in hospitality industry with proven experience as Lead Line Cook, Sous Chef or equivalent kitchen leadership in fine dining restaurant
- ability to lead and motivate kitchen team
- knowledge of kitchen operations and food safety standards
- strong organizational and multitasking skills
- experience with inventory management and cost control
- excellent communication and interpersonal skills
Job Duties
- Oversee kitchen operations
- ensure all stations are set up, stocked and running smoothly for service
- lead and support staff by assigning tasks and delegating workload
- work all stations including expo
- assist with ordering, inventory, scheduling, and new menu rollouts
- help manage labor cost
- check deliveries, verify quality, and ensure proper storage
